Leaked source code of windows server 2003
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

108 lines
2.8 KiB

  1. ; MGSYNC.INF
  2. ;
  3. ; Microgate MGT1/SyncLink X.25 and SDLC Adapter inf
  4. ;
  5. ; Copyright (c) Microsoft Corporation. All rights reserved.
  6. [version]
  7. Signature = "$Windows NT$"
  8. Class = Net
  9. ClassGUID = {4d36e972-e325-11ce-bfc1-08002be10318}
  10. Provider = %V_MGATE%
  11. LayoutFile = layout.inf
  12. [Manufacturer]
  13. %V_MGATE%=MGATE
  14. [ControlFlags]
  15. ExcludeFromSelect = PCI\VEN_13C0&DEV_0010
  16. InteractiveInstall = mgate_pci_DEV_0010
  17. [MGATE]
  18. ; DisplayName Section DeviceID
  19. ; ----------- ------- --------
  20. ;%mgate_mgt1.DeviceDesc% = mgate_mgt1.ndi, Mgt1Isa
  21. ;%mgate_mgsl.DeviceDesc% = mgate_mgsl.ndi, PCI\VEN_13C0&DEV_0010, mgate_pci_DEV_0010
  22. ; *************************************
  23. ; Microgate SyncLink X.25/SDLC Adapter
  24. ; *************************************
  25. [mgate_mgsl.ndi]
  26. Characteristics = 0x4
  27. BusType = 5
  28. AddReg = mgate_mgsl.staticparams.reg,mgate_mgsl.reg
  29. CopyFiles = mgate_drivers.CopyFiles, mgate_system.CopyFiles
  30. [mgate_mgsl.ndi.Services]
  31. AddService = MGSYNC, 2, mgate_mgt1.Service, common.EventLog
  32. [mgate_mgsl.reg]
  33. HKR, Ndi, Service, 0, "MGSYNC"
  34. HKR, NDI\Interfaces, UpperRange, 0, "noupper"
  35. HKR, NDI\Interfaces, LowerRange, 0, "mgsync"
  36. [mgate_mgsl.staticparams.reg]
  37. HKR,,EnumPropPages32,0,"slpp.dll,SlppPageProvider"
  38. ; ********************************
  39. ; Microgate MGT1 X.25/SDLC Adapter
  40. ; ********************************
  41. [mgate_mgt1.ndi]
  42. Characteristics = 0x4
  43. BusType = 1
  44. AddReg = mgate_mgt1.staticparams.reg,mgate_mgt1.reg
  45. LogConfig = mgate_mgt1.LogConfig
  46. CopyFiles = mgate_drivers.CopyFiles, mgate_system.CopyFiles
  47. [mgate_mgt1.ndi.Services]
  48. AddService = MGSYNC, 2, mgate_mgt1.Service, common.EventLog
  49. [mgate_mgt1.LogConfig]
  50. ConfigPriority = HARDRECONFIG
  51. IOConfig = 300-30f,310-31f,200-20f,210-21f,100-10f,110-11f,120-12f
  52. IRQConfig = 9,10,11,12,5,3,4,15
  53. DMAConfig = 1,0,3,5,7
  54. [mgate_mgt1.reg]
  55. HKR, Ndi, Service, 0, "MGSYNC"
  56. HKR, NDI\Interfaces, UpperRange, 0, "noupper"
  57. HKR, NDI\Interfaces, LowerRange, 0, "mgsync"
  58. [mgate_mgt1.staticparams.reg]
  59. HKR,,EnumPropPages32,0,"slpp.dll,SlppPageProvider"
  60. ;; **********************
  61. ;; *** Common Install ***
  62. ;; **********************
  63. [mgate_drivers.CopyFiles]
  64. mgsync5.sys,,,2
  65. [mgate_system.CopyFiles]
  66. slpp.dll,,,2
  67. [mgate_mgt1.Service]
  68. DisplayName = %mgate_mgt1.Service.DispName%
  69. ServiceType = 1 ;%SERVICE_KERNEL_DRIVER%
  70. StartType = 3 ;%SERVICE_MANUAL_START%
  71. ErrorControl = 1 ;%SERVICE_ERROR_NORMAL%
  72. ServiceBinary = %12%\mgsync5.sys
  73. [common.EventLog]
  74. AddReg = common.EventLog.reg
  75. [common.EventLog.reg]
  76. HKR,,EventMessageFile,0x00020000,"%%SystemRoot%%\System32\Drivers\mgsync5.sys"
  77. HKR,,TypesSupported,0x00010001,7
  78. [DestinationDirs]
  79. mgate_drivers.CopyFiles = 12
  80. mgate_system.CopyFiles = 11